Does participatory governance hold its promises?

"With the ratification of the Reform Treaty, the European Union will be based on two complementary principles: the principle of representative democracy and the principle of participatory democracy. Even though the two respective sub-headings in the draft Constitutional Treaty (Article I, 46 and Article I, 47) have been omitted, the Intergovernmental Conference did not introduce any change in substance. Article 11 of the Reform Treaty pledges to give citizens and representative associations a voice 'in all areas of Union action', and to 'maintain an open, transparent and regular dialogue with representative associations and civil society', and it demands that the Commission 'carry out broad consultations with parties concerned in order to ensure that the Union's actions are coherent and transparent'. With Clause 4, it now also endows citizens with the right to initiate an action. However, first, that action is of one type only, i.e., 'where citizens consider that a legal act of the Union is required for the purpose of implementing the Treaties'. Second, that action is valid only when 'not less than one million citizens who are nationals of a significant number of Member States' engage in it. Third, and most importantly, that action is only an invitation to the Commission, one which the Commission is not obliged to accept." (excerpt)
